#674 - Ralph Shaw The Ralph Shaw Interview is featured on The Paul Leslie Hour. Ralph Shaw is an entertainer who performs on a banjo-ukulele. He is a witty recording artist and showman with a love and passion for performing. He's also a great songwriter who's tender and comical songs are deceptively sophisticated. In addition to his original songs, he interprets many of the classic songs from the Tin Pan Alley era of American music. His work, including solo albums and a book, has played a crucial role in creating the current ukulele boom. He joins us to talk about his musical world, his songwriting and more. Season 1: Race and the News Media Episode 4: Setting the Tone In this episode of "Roundtables on Race," host the Rev. Kathy Walker explores the media's role and responsibility in "setting the tone," especially in respect to potential conversations news reports can encourage. She is joined by guests Paul Cuadros, an award-winning investigative reporter, author and professor at the University of North Carolina - Chapel Hill's Hussman School of Journalism and Media; Ralph Shaw, morning host at WTOB radio in Winston-Salem, North Carolina, whose decades-long career includes time as a news director, assignment editor, reporter, news anchor and contract news correspondent in both radio and television; and Skip Foster, former president and publisher of the Tallahassee Democrat, during whose 30-year career he was often called a consummate newsman.
